The A1278 uses a specific audio chipset that requires a companion driver to handle audio processing. While Windows 10 is excellent at finding generic drivers, it often defaults to a generic "High Definition Audio" driver. This allows sound to play, but it bypasses the custom EQ and hardware controls that make the MacBook speakers sound full and rich.

Maybe the volume is stuck on mute, the microphone doesn't work, or—most commonly—the sound plays, but it is tinny, flat, and lacks bass. This is a notorious issue with the A1278 model when running Windows. The default Windows drivers simply don’t know how to talk to the specific audio hardware (usually Cirrus Logic) inside your Mac.
